A long-established and highly regarded testing facility is expanding its team! Offering solutions for certification and quality control and assurance to testing and inspection for a variety of construction / civil services such as contaminated land investigations, ground investigations, waste testing etc. With a strong reputation for technical expertise and precision, this is an exciting opportunity to join a trusted name in the field. If you're looking for a role in a cutting-edge testing environment, this could be the perfect fit for you!

The Role:

  • Supervise daily laboratory and site services, ensuring efficient and profitable operations.
  • Communicate effectively with departmental staff and management to support overall performance.
  • Prepare and monitor departmental budgets, collating KPIs and taking action to maintain or improve results.
  • Recruit, train, and develop staff, fostering a proactive and supportive team culture.
  • Have an input in conjunction with company management and Sales staff to achieve development, growth/expansion of business via new client and business opportunities.
  • Preparing quotations/proposals and supporting this process in other departments as necessary.
  • Preparing specialist testing reports and authorising issue of reports.
  • Ensure compliance with UKAS, ISO 17025, and quality standards, including QA/QC processes and internal audits.

What you need?

  • Previous experience in a Geoenvironmental Engineer or Geotechnical Engineer role
  • Aspirations to run a department and take on a management role
  • Strong understanding of legal frameworks and requirements, along with excellent technical skills and extensive knowledge of ground investigation, contaminated land, waste testing, and materials testing and assessment.
  • Degree in Geology or Environmental Chemistry (desirable).
  • Hold full UK driving licence.
